Chemotherapy Response Monitoring With 18F-choline PET/CT in Hormone Refractory Prostate Cancer

Queen's Medical Center·interventional·Posted Jun 25, 2009·Updated Aug 14, 2017

In Brief

A Phase 2 clinical trial evaluating IV fluorine-18 labeled methylcholine before PET/CT for Hormone Refractory Prostate Cancer. Completed, enrolled 25 participants across 1 site.

Detailed Summary

The purpose of this study is to determine whether imaging with 18F-choline PET/CT can provide information that may help guide subsequent investigational or clinical treatments for patients with advanced (hormone-refractory) metastatic prostate cancer.
